Walmart has 75" TCL 4K UHD HDR Smart Roku TV (75S451) on sale for $538. Select free store pick up where stock permits. Free delivery may be available in some areas, otherwise freight shipping starts at $49.95.
  • Note: Availability for free store pick up may vary by location.
Thanks to Community Member supersizedkid for finding this deal.

TV Specs:
  • Resolution: 3840x2160 (4K UHD)
  • Refresh rate: 60Hz
  • HDR: HDR10
  • Smart platform: Roku
  • Ports:
    • 4x HDMI 2.0
    • 1x USB
    • 1x Optical Audio Out
    • 1x Ethernet

I have a 65" series 4. Got it in June of 2018, and it's worked great. It's not amazing quality (compared to Mini LED or OLED), but also hard to beat for the price point.

It just started acting up. Turns on, but video content won't play. Netflix, HBO, etc loads, and the menu is visible, but the videos don't play and no sound. I unplugged it for a minute, and got it to work again. I've done this maybe 3 times over the last few months, so I'm shopping for a TV now. Figured it was on it's last leg.

Paid $600, and got almost 5 years out of it. I'm okay with that.

edit: It's not very bright. If you have a bright room, I would pass. Works fine for my room since I don't have any windows behind it, and have shades on the side windows.

FYI:
- direct lit (vs full array)
- doesn't support Dolby Vision
- states 1B colors which means 10bit screen?!? I doubt it. Probably 8bit with FRC. At 60hz refresh no local dimming, you may see some ghosting.

Good enough for a loft, playroom.

I have the 55" model series 4 and it's been awesome for at least 4 yrs now, hence why I am inserted in this.

Of note, the reviews boil down to:
Recent purchases: awesome, high ratings
Older/longer ownership: software update made the TV unusable or limited. No update on that negative although I would assume a patch was pushed to fix it.

Overall I've been impressed with TCL enough to try again. Consider an extended warranty if you're worried about it and like warranties.

I don't game, just stream.
